Itinerary Highlights

Málaga: 3-Hour Complete Walking Tour With Tickets - Itinerary Highlights

The tour begins at the Crystal Pyramid on Calle Alcazabilla, where participants meet their guide. Over the next three hours, the tour explores Málaga’s key historical sites, starting with a guided visit to the Roman Theatre. Next, the group heads to the Alcazaba of Málaga, a well-preserved Moorish fortress, for a 45-minute guided tour. The walking tour then continues through the city’s historical center, passing by the Cathedral of the Incarnation, also known as "La Manquita". Additional notable sites include the Bodega Bar El Pimpi and the Picasso Museum.

Included Experiences

Málaga: 3-Hour Complete Walking Tour With Tickets - Included Experiences

The guided tour includes various notable experiences throughout Malaga’s historical sites.

Guests will begin with a 30-minute guided tour of the Roman Theatre, an impressive ancient ruin dating back to the 1st century BC.

Next, they’ll explore the Alcazaba, a well-preserved Moorish fortress, with a 45-minute guided tour.

The tour also includes a stroll through the city’s historical center, allowing visitors to admire the striking Cathedral of the Incarnation, also known as "La Manquita."

Plus, the tour provides access to the Picasso Museum and the Bodega Bar El Pimpi, offering a glimpse into Malaga’s artistic and culinary heritage.
